Our award-winning School of Arts & Creative Industries (SACI)hosts a range of undergraduate and postgraduate programmes and plays an active part in the creative industries across Scotland.

We are widely recognised for our expertise and excellence in creative practice, enhanced by extensive international collaboration, providing both staff and students with the opportunity to work and study worldwide.

Our base in Edinburgh is the world’s first UNESCO City of Literature and the home of Scottish publishing. Each year, the capital is host to a number of internationally celebrated literary and publishing events, including the Publishing Scotland and Booksellers Association Scottish Book Trade Conference, Scotland’s National Book Awards, Comic Con Scotland, and the world-renowned Edinburgh International Book Festival.
